Fragment of a Lappet1750-1760

Not on view
Framed strip of cream-colored floral bobbin or needle lace mounted on salmon-pink fabric, with repeating flower and scrolling leaf motifs on an open mesh ground
Needle lace border in cream-white thread, displayed on a red ground, with a fine mesh ground and raised floral and leaf motifs in a continuous scrolling pattern along both scalloped edges.
Title
Fragment of a Lappet
Place Made
Belgium
Date Made
1750-1760
Medium
Linen and silk lace (Mechlin)
Dimensions
14 1/2 × 4 1/4 in. (36.83 × 10.8 cm)
Credit Line
Purchased with funds provided by Mr. and Mrs. John J. Garland
Accession Number
M.57.8.5
Classification
Textiles
Collecting Area
Costume and Textiles
